A while back, I wassearching high and low for plans or other bits of information that would allow me to re-construct the Top-Flite Taurus, but I flew one back in the late 70's, early 80's.
Back then, everyone who was someone had a Taurus and since then, I have always wanted to get my hands on one.

While searching, I stumbled across a thread on RCU that mentioned that the Taurus had been re-drawn and was kitted under the name Primus.
I ordered one from Jeff Petroski and received the kit within two weeks from ordering. Excellent turnaround for an order from the States to Australia.

The new kit is all laser cut and included top quality accessories such as Dubro clevises etc etc.
The laser cutting looks top notch.

Having the kit here has me all excited and wantiong to start building.
This is just like winning the big one in the Lottery !!!

I am planning to build the kit as close to the original appearance as possible.
Colour scheme will be the same as the one on the cover of MAN all thosed years ago.
Unlike the original though, I'll probably use Monokote and the engine will obviously be a modern one.

Like Ed Kazmirski's original one, the engine will most likely be mounted upright. I need to ponder this a bit though.

The underside is the same as the top. At the nose on the right side, in front of the blue accent stripe, Ed had printed "Taurus". It was not on the left hand side. As for the font, MS Word has "Fritzer" which is as close as I can get. Other good fonts are Kristen ITC, Forte, or Don Casual (stretched)
